Hunter Taylor puts South Carolina ahead with go-ahead double in the top of the 9th

The sophomore, who wasn't even supposed to start today, comes up big.

Hunter Taylor wasn't supposed to be in the lineup today. The sophomore got the start in place of John Jones - who was held out because he was late to a pregame team meal - and came in with one RBI all season long.

Well, make that two. Taylor's RBI double with one out gave South Carolina a 3-2 lead over Duke in the top of the ninth. It would turn out to be the game winner as the Gamecocks added a run later in the inning to beat the Blue Devils, 4-2.
